#dcd4f2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#dcd4f2 is composed of 86.3% red, 83.1%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 9.1% cyan, 12.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 256 degrees, a saturation of 53.6% and a lightness of 89%. #dcd4f2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#b9a9e5.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

#dcd4f2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#dcd4f2 has RGB values of R:220, G:212, B:242 and CMYK values of C:0.09, M:0.12,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 14472434.

Shades and Tints of #dcd4f2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010102 is the darkest color, while #f5f2fb is the lightest one.
